The OB Flex Team is a highly skilled group of nurses who float across all obstetric and neonatal areas to support staffing needs on both the Downtown and West Campuses.

This team provides flexible, cross-trained coverage to the NICU, Mother Baby, Labor and Delivery, and OB Emergency Department/Antepartum units, ensuring seamless patient care during periods of high census, acuity, or staffing shortages.

By adapting quickly to unit needs, the OB Flex Team enhances continuity of care, supports frontline staff, and helps maintain safe, high-quality outcomes for mothers and newborns across all locations mentioned below: Neonatal Intensive Care Unit East Tower, 4th Floor This dedicated unit consists of 62 beds in 44 private patient rooms and is located in the East Tower.

Credentialed as a Level III NICU, practicing highly technical, state-of-the-art care for high-risk premature babies and full-term newborns in need of specialized care.

Nurses work with neonatologists, cardiologists, surgeons and other medical specialties as a team approach to care and provide the best care for infants.

Mother Baby Unit East Tower, 2nd floor This unit has 40 private rooms for both high risk and low risk postpartum patients, post-operative surgery and medical patients. As part of MercyOne Children’s Hospital the unit also has a newborn nursery. Nursing and medical providers work together as a team to deliver care for the newborn, mother as well as medical patients.

Labor and Delivery Unit East Tower, 3rd Floor This unit includes 15 labor and delivery recovery suites, three surgical suites and four post anesthesia recovery beds. As part of MercyOne Children’s Hospital, the labor and delivery unit offers a variety of birthing methods and pain management options.

OB Emergency Department – Antepartum Unit East Tower, 3rd Floor Part of MercyOne Children’s Hospital this state of the art obstetrical unit cares for low and high risk antepartum patients, pregnant patients greater than 20 weeks with other medical diagnoses.

The unit consists of a seven room triage area designed to assess and observe patients, a 10 bed inpatient area and ultrasound area that is staffed 24 hours a day, seven days a week.

POSITION PURPOSE Provides individualized, high-quality nursing care to patients of all ages.

Uses a team approach to delegate and coordinate patient care at admission, transfer, and discharge.

Independently delivers nursing care using the Nurse Practice Act, Mercy Medical Center policies, nursing standards, ethical principles, and professional judgment.

Works rotating shifts, weekends, and holidays as scheduled.

Provides nursing care across all units within trained specialty 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S Knows, understands, incorporates, and demonstrates the Trinity Health Mission, Vision, and Values in behaviors, practices, and decisions.

Assesses, plans, and implements nursing care while ensuring patient comfort.

Practices safe patient handling techniques.

Continues to evaluate assigned patients and provides ongoing treatment.

Anticipates, identifies, and responds to educational and emotional needs of patients and families.

Guides and directs healthcare personnel (i.e.

Patient Care Technicians) in caring for patients.

Maintains knowledge of equipment set-up, maintenance, and use (i.e., IV pumps, monitoring equipment, and drainage devices).

Utilizes safeguards such as IV pump drug library and monitor alarms whenever available to maximize patient safety.

Initiates emergency support measures (i.e., cardiopulmonary resuscitation, protecting patient from injury).

Serves in a charge/leadership role based on skill and unit needs.

When assigned charge, makes patient assignments; triages patients; and problem solves with staff, physicians, patients, families, and ancillary departments.

Takes assigned call as defined in unit policy.

Assists with patient care duties/tasks (i.e., emptying drainage devices, ambulating, and hygiene).

Assists with clerical duties (i.e., maintenance of chart, patient record, and answering phones and call lights).

Maintains patient care supplies, equipment, and environment.

Provides orientation/education for staff, students, and other hospital and community organizations as requested.

Other duties as needed and assigned by the manager.

Maintains a working knowledge of applicable Federal, State, and local laws and regulations, Trinity Health’s Organizational Integrity Program, Standards of Conduct, as well as other policies and procedures in order to ensure adherence in a manner that reflects honest, ethical, and professional behavior.

Minimum Qualifications

Possession of a current or compact state license as a Registered Nurse issued/defined by the State of Iowa. BSN preferred. Proof of completion of Mandatory Reporter – Child and/or Dependent Adult Abuse training within three (3) months of hire. Basic Life Support certified within six (6) weeks of hire. Acceptable credentialing bodies and certifications include American Heart Association Basic Life Support. Advanced Cardiac Life Support certified within nine (9) months of hire, if required by your department. Must be comfortable operating in a collaborative, shared leadership environment.
